Output 51a616d091a5a09ff2f40f2a5c9986ccb81e2918eeb67f5c8e7fb69e83a5989c:1

value
304149
script pubkey
OP_0 OP_PUSHBYTES_20 e2b94f5d9a31ee5083bd38ad0c59b7a13713b6d3
address
bc1qu2u57hv6x8h9pqaa8zksckdh5ym38dkngtqew4
transaction
51a616d091a5a09ff2f40f2a5c9986ccb81e2918eeb67f5c8e7fb69e83a5989c
confirmations
159431
spent
true